Bournemouth Water is working in partnership with Citizens Advice in East Dorset and Purbeck to help support its Advice Bus initiative, bringing essential advice and support direct to residents in rural locations.
Now in its second year, the Advice Bus operates five days a week and offers free, face-to-face guidance on a range of issues including debt, housing, and water bills.
In its first year, the service reached over 1,000 residents in rural areas including more than 300 people who were new to Citizens Advice.
Bournemouth Water customers can receive support on managing their bills, helping them to access affordability schemes such as FreshStart and set up manageable payment plans which are tailored to their needs.
Through financial support and ongoing collaboration with Citizens Advice, Bournemouth Water is helping to ensure customers in rural areas are not left behind when it comes to accessing vital services.

This partnership forms part of Bournemouth Water’s broader commitment to supporting vulnerable customers and working with community organisations to deliver practical, local support.
Bournemouth Water currently supports over 3,000 customers each year through its affordability packages.
Paul Gosling, Head of Business and Development, Citizens Advice in East Dorset & Purbeck said: “We are very appreciative of the support Bournemouth Water has provided towards our Advice Bus. It has enabled us to have trained Advisers on our bus who can offer a wide range of advice services to residents who are rurally isolated.”
